Index: HelenOS.config
===================================================================
--- HelenOS.config	(revision 2e231aba2f8ff8ab107145e459a104ee6792090f)
+++ HelenOS.config	(revision a63d216495adb3387eab99c836001a569678383b)
@@ -609,10 +609,4 @@
 ! [CONFIG_DEBUG=y] CONFIG_TEST_DRIVERS (n/y)
 
-% Load disk drivers on startup
-! CONFIG_START_BD (n/y)
-
-% Mount /data on startup
-! [CONFIG_START_BD=y] CONFIG_MOUNT_DATA (n/y)
-
 % Write core files
 ! CONFIG_WRITE_CORE_FILES (n/y)
Index: defaults/amd64/Makefile.config
===================================================================
--- defaults/amd64/Makefile.config	(revision 2e231aba2f8ff8ab107145e459a104ee6792090f)
+++ defaults/amd64/Makefile.config	(revision a63d216495adb3387eab99c836001a569678383b)
@@ -59,10 +59,4 @@
 CONFIG_BFB_BPP = 16
 
-# Load disk drivers on startup
-CONFIG_START_BD = n
-
-# Mount /data on startup
-CONFIG_MOUNT_DATA = n
-
 # OHCI root hub power switch, ganged is enough
 OHCI_POWER_SWITCH = ganged
Index: defaults/arm32/Makefile.config
===================================================================
--- defaults/arm32/Makefile.config	(revision 2e231aba2f8ff8ab107145e459a104ee6792090f)
+++ defaults/arm32/Makefile.config	(revision a63d216495adb3387eab99c836001a569678383b)
@@ -34,9 +34,2 @@
 # What is your output device?
 CONFIG_HID_OUT = generic
-
-# Load disk drivers on startup
-CONFIG_START_BD = n
-
-# Mount /data on startup
-CONFIG_MOUNT_DATA = n
-
Index: defaults/ia32/Makefile.config
===================================================================
--- defaults/ia32/Makefile.config	(revision 2e231aba2f8ff8ab107145e459a104ee6792090f)
+++ defaults/ia32/Makefile.config	(revision a63d216495adb3387eab99c836001a569678383b)
@@ -65,10 +65,4 @@
 CONFIG_BFB_BPP = 16
 
-# Load disk drivers on startup
-CONFIG_START_BD = n
-
-# Mount /data on startup
-CONFIG_MOUNT_DATA = n
-
 # OHCI root hub power switch, ganged is enough
 OHCI_POWER_SWITCH = ganged
Index: defaults/ia64/Makefile.config
===================================================================
--- defaults/ia64/Makefile.config	(revision 2e231aba2f8ff8ab107145e459a104ee6792090f)
+++ defaults/ia64/Makefile.config	(revision a63d216495adb3387eab99c836001a569678383b)
@@ -46,9 +46,2 @@
 # Output device class
 CONFIG_HID_OUT = generic
-
-# Load disk drivers on startup
-CONFIG_START_BD = n
-
-# Mount /data on startup
-CONFIG_MOUNT_DATA = n
-
Index: defaults/mips32/Makefile.config
===================================================================
--- defaults/mips32/Makefile.config	(revision 2e231aba2f8ff8ab107145e459a104ee6792090f)
+++ defaults/mips32/Makefile.config	(revision a63d216495adb3387eab99c836001a569678383b)
@@ -41,10 +41,4 @@
 CONFIG_HID_OUT = generic
 
-# Load disk drivers on startup
-CONFIG_START_BD = n
-
-# Mount /data on startup
-CONFIG_MOUNT_DATA = n
-
 # Barebone build with essential binaries only 
 CONFIG_BAREBONE = y
Index: defaults/mips64/Makefile.config
===================================================================
--- defaults/mips64/Makefile.config	(revision 2e231aba2f8ff8ab107145e459a104ee6792090f)
+++ defaults/mips64/Makefile.config	(revision a63d216495adb3387eab99c836001a569678383b)
@@ -40,9 +40,2 @@
 # Output device class
 CONFIG_HID_OUT = generic
-
-# Load disk drivers on startup
-CONFIG_START_BD = n
-
-# Mount /data on startup
-CONFIG_MOUNT_DATA = n
-
Index: defaults/ppc32/Makefile.config
===================================================================
--- defaults/ppc32/Makefile.config	(revision 2e231aba2f8ff8ab107145e459a104ee6792090f)
+++ defaults/ppc32/Makefile.config	(revision a63d216495adb3387eab99c836001a569678383b)
@@ -38,10 +38,4 @@
 CONFIG_FB = y
 
-# Load disk drivers on startup
-CONFIG_START_BD = n
-
-# Mount /data on startup
-CONFIG_MOUNT_DATA = n
-
 # OHCI root hub power switch, ganged is enough
 OHCI_POWER_SWITCH = ganged
Index: defaults/sparc32/Makefile.config
===================================================================
--- defaults/sparc32/Makefile.config	(revision 2e231aba2f8ff8ab107145e459a104ee6792090f)
+++ defaults/sparc32/Makefile.config	(revision a63d216495adb3387eab99c836001a569678383b)
@@ -52,9 +52,2 @@
 # Start AP processors by the loader
 CONFIG_AP = y
-
-# Load disk drivers on startup
-CONFIG_START_BD = n
-
-# Mount /data on startup
-CONFIG_MOUNT_DATA = n
-
Index: defaults/sparc64/Makefile.config
===================================================================
--- defaults/sparc64/Makefile.config	(revision 2e231aba2f8ff8ab107145e459a104ee6792090f)
+++ defaults/sparc64/Makefile.config	(revision a63d216495adb3387eab99c836001a569678383b)
@@ -52,9 +52,2 @@
 # Start AP processors by the loader
 CONFIG_AP = y
-
-# Load disk drivers on startup
-CONFIG_START_BD = n
-
-# Mount /data on startup
-CONFIG_MOUNT_DATA = n
-
Index: defaults/special/Makefile.config
===================================================================
--- defaults/special/Makefile.config	(revision 2e231aba2f8ff8ab107145e459a104ee6792090f)
+++ defaults/special/Makefile.config	(revision a63d216495adb3387eab99c836001a569678383b)
@@ -28,6 +28,2 @@
 # Compile kernel tests
 CONFIG_TEST = y
-
-# Load disk drivers on startup
-CONFIG_START_BD = n
-
Index: uspace/app/init/init.c
===================================================================
--- uspace/app/init/init.c	(revision 2e231aba2f8ff8ab107145e459a104ee6792090f)
+++ uspace/app/init/init.c	(revision a63d216495adb3387eab99c836001a569678383b)
@@ -59,8 +59,4 @@
 #define TMPFS_FS_TYPE      "tmpfs"
 #define TMPFS_MOUNT_POINT  "/tmp"
-
-#define DATA_FS_TYPE      "fat"
-#define DATA_DEVICE       "bd/ata1disk0"
-#define DATA_MOUNT_POINT  "/data"
 
 #define SRV_CONSOLE  "/srv/console"
@@ -316,11 +312,4 @@
 }
 
-static bool mount_data(void)
-{
-	int rc = mount(DATA_FS_TYPE, DATA_MOUNT_POINT, DATA_DEVICE, "wtcache", 0, 0);
-	return mount_report("Data filesystem", DATA_MOUNT_POINT, DATA_FS_TYPE,
-	    DATA_DEVICE, rc);
-}
-
 int main(int argc, char *argv[])
 {
@@ -366,22 +355,4 @@
 	srv_start("/srv/clipboard");
 	srv_start("/srv/remcons");
-	
-	/*
-	 * Start these synchronously so that mount_data() can be
-	 * non-blocking.
-	 */
-#ifdef CONFIG_START_BD
-	srv_start("/srv/ata_bd");
-#endif
-	
-#ifdef CONFIG_MOUNT_DATA
-	/* Make sure fat is running. */
-	if (str_cmp(STRING(RDFMT), "fat") != 0)
-		srv_start("/srv/fat");
-	
-	mount_data();
-#else
-	(void) mount_data;
-#endif
 	
 	srv_start("/srv/input", HID_INPUT);
